New Oscott Retirement Village, part of the Extra Care Charitable Trust, is recruiting a Housekeeper.

This role is based at New Oscott Village in Birmingham within a supportive team in our friendly retirement community.

You will maintain communal areas and support residents with a compassionate, flexible approach. 15 hours per week at £13.45 per hour, pro rata of a full-time salary, with benefits including generous holiday, life insurance, pension contributions, and staff development.
